Ben Shannon - Biography

Ben Shannon was born in New Albany, Mississippi to Rita and Johnny. While in grade school, Shannon was very active in church and school theater, playing the roles of Friedrich in "The Sound of Music" and Cmdr. Harbison in "South Pacific" among others.

In college, Shannon was involved in a car accident that resulted in the amputation of his right leg above the knee. This experience sparked his interest in emergency medicine and flight nursing. After his recovery, Shannon became a flight nurse on a medical helicopter. Realizing that he missed acting and performing, Shannon joined Amputees in Hollywood to gain film experience. In 2014, he had his first role as a feature extra in "NCIS: New Orleans" (Season 2, Epsiode 10).
